scientific tests in rodents applying radiolabelled dopamine in synaptosomes observed that THC prompted enhanced dopamine synthesis31 and release24 (Fig. two). Nevertheless, the effects on dopamine uptake yielded conflicting benefits, with proof of the two increases32 and dose-dependent decreases24. Subsequently biphasic and triphasic effects of THC had been uncovered, whereby very low doses of THC produced increases within the conversion of tyrosine to dopamine, but high doses of THC resulted in decreased dopamine synthesis33.

Scientific tests of metabolic brain action in people utilizing useful magnetic resonance imaging (fMRI) and positron emission tomography (PET) provide indirect actions of dopaminergic functionality by changes in cerebral blood move and glucose metabolism. These serve as surrogate markers of Mind action in places with dopaminergic projections. In human beings, acute THC is related to greater action in frontal and sub-cortical regions52. Nevertheless, as being the CB1R has the very best concentrations in these regions53 these findings may be as a result of direct endocannabinoid effects as opposed to reflecting dopamine-mediated processes. When studies of acute THC on resting brain exercise have focussed on areas with dense dopaminergic innervation, like the striatum, there have already been inconsistent effects, with studies of both of those greater and reduced activity52.
